Bean soup is on the menu in the Senate's restaurant every day. There are several<br>stories about the origin of that mandate, but none has been corroborated. According to one story, the Senate’s bean<br>soup tradition began early in the 20th-century at the request of Senator Fred Dubois of Idaho. Ingredients
½ package of 32 oz. Idahoan® CREAMY Butter & Herb Mashed Potatoes
3 lbs dried navy beans
2 lbs of ham and a ham bone
3 gallons water or stock
5 onions, chopped
4 cups celery, chopped
4 cups carrots, chopped
4 cloves garlic, chopped
½ a bunch of parsley, chopped
Instructions
Clean the beans, cook and drain.
Add ham, bone and water or stock and bring to a boil.
Add chopped vegetables and return to a boil. Reduce heat and simmer for one hour.
Mix in potatoes and continue simmering for a half hour.
Stir in parsley in the last 5 minutes before serving.
